  • Patent number: 4771400
    Abstract: A bit density controller is capable of transmitting no more than 15 consecutive 0-bits to be sent serially in a data bit sequence, without a 1-bit, for operating on the AT&T T1 network. The bit density controller includes a state machine having a state index and a substitution device coupled to the state machine. The bit density controller additionally can include a buffer for storing at least one frame of the data bit sequence, a memory for storing overhead bits, and an overhead bit inserter for inserting overhead bits into the data bit sequence.

  • Patent number: 4763888
    Abstract: A flat mail collator is provided having a flat base with a rectangular shape and a handle connected to the flat support. A plurality of leaves having a rectangular shape are connected to the flat base for defining spaces between the adjacent ones of the leaves. The plurality of leaves are coded for a plurality of addresses for sorting mail by address by inserting individual pieces of mail between these. Upon completion of the sorting operation, the mail is removed from the leaves by the lifting the flat base by the handles and tilting the flat base and allowing the sorted mail to slip from between the leaves and remain sorted.

  • Patent number: 4764734
    Abstract: A class SM amplifier is provided having a threshold circuit with a plurality of threshold levels for generating a plurality of threshold signals. In response to an input signal passing a particular threshold level, the threshold circuit generates as an output a particular threshold signal. A voltage supply is provided having a plurality of voltage levels. The class SM amplifier includes a plurality of transistors coupled to a load and the threshold circuit, and the plurality of voltage levels from the voltage supply. The transistors switch a particular voltage level across the load in response to a particular threshold signal from the threshold circuit. The plurality of voltage levels are adjusted to approximate the input signal.

  • Patent number: 4675606
    Abstract: A passive system for detecting the position and trajectory of a moving body, moving in the air, on the ocean or below the ocean. This apparatus operates by detecting perturbations in the earth's magnetic field responsive to the movement of a body through the field. At least two spaced magnetometers are provided to detect the perturbations of the earth's magnetic field, whereas, the system works more efficiently with an array of sensors. These two sensors are used to filter out the ambient noise. The outputs of these sensors are digitized and inverted through correlation procedures and an output is provided on a display.

  • Patent number: 4658345
    Abstract: A circuit for automatically operating a switching power supply is capable of operating from first and second input voltage ranges. The circuit changes the switching power supply from a full-wave rectifier circuit to a voltage doubler rectifier circuit by electrically connecting first and second nodes. The circuit includes a rectifier circuit and a voltage level sensing device for generating an output voltage to trigger a triac, which connects the first and second nodes.

  • Patent number: 4593353
    Abstract: In a method of and apparatus for limiting program execution to only an authorized data processing system, a proprietary program, together with first and second authorization codes, is stored on a magnetic disc or other storage medium. The first and second authorization codes are read. A hardware module containing a pseudorandom number generator unique to the authorized system receives the first authorization code as a key. The resultant number generated by the number generator, which is a function of the key and particular pseudorandom generator algorithm, is compared with the second authorization code in direct or encrypted form. An execution enable signal is generated in response to a positive comparison to enable the stored program to be executed.
